Fans have been getting the newly released MPG 09 Ginrai, which includes his trailer to turn him into Super Ginrai. However, an issue has come up with the connection point near the smokestacks when turning Ginrai into Super Ginrai. Those tabs snap off, and we have proof of two instances along with several other reports. A piece of Ginrai's white crotch-plate in normal mode has also been confirmed to break off.

Of course, not everyone has their copy yet, so we don't know how widespread these issues are, we just want to give you a heads up to be extra careful at that connection point. Posted by Sabrblade on January 4th, 2025 @ 2:49pm CST
Hero Alpha wrote:Also I thought MP was over, is this one of the last ones or are :TAKARATOMY: just doing kinda random one offs from now on.
There are two lines, Masterpiece and MPG, and both have their own Ginrai release. MP-60 Ginrai is the toy-accurate version that is just the cab robot, while MPG-09 Super Ginrai is the show-accurate version that is both the cab robot and the trailer. MP-60 Ginrai is the final release in the Masterpiece line, while MPG is continuing with more releases to come after MPG-09 Super Ginrai.

Posted by william-james88 on January 14th, 2025 @ 11:01pm CST
We thank Sabrblade for letting us know of a slew of new official images of MPG-15 Masterpiece Rattrap. These images show that the pack peg on MP Primal will be used to affix Rattrap to his back. We even see that famous shot of them riding into action on Rhinox' back. We also see a shot of the Maximal team with Rattrap, which shows his scale. As with many of the previous Beast Wars MPs, the beast mode head on his chest in robot mode is a piece of fake kibble but it can be seen on the belly of the rat mode.
